India, March 29 -- While almost everyone on the internet has hopped on the trend of generating Studio-Ghibli inspired images within a matter of just a few prompts, the trend has taken a toll on OpenAI's graphic processing units (GPUs).
Soon after the frenzy over the anime-style image generation took over, OpenAI's CEO Sam Altman on Thursday took to his social media and said that their GPUs are "melting" because of it.
"It's super fun seeing people love images in ChatGPT. but our GPUs are melting. we are going to temporarily introduce some rate limits while we work on making it more efficient. hopefully won't be long! ChatGPT free tier will get 3 generations per day soon," Sam Altman said in a post on X (formerly Twitter).
